Konstantin (Constantin) Stanislavski ( / ) (January 5, 1863 - August 7, 1938) was a Russian theatre and acting innovator.. Born Constantin Sergeievich Alexeyev in Moscow to a wealthy family, Constantin made his first acting appearance at the age of seven. Stanislavski's system is a systematic approach to training actors that the Russian theatre practitioner Konstantin Stanislavski developed in the first half of the twentieth century. His system cultivates what he calls the "art of experiencing" (with which he contrasts the "art of representation").It mobilises the actor's conscious thought and will in order to activate other, less-controllable .
